That is the advantage of grass root organizations. They are small and manageable with some voluntary efforts. As soon as it gets bigger with a much bigger impact as well, people need to get involved full-time to be able to manage it on a professional level. Also to insure continuing proper management. But then it's tricky, where does the money come from for these people? Nobody wants to donate for that...
